DESCRIPTION
I was trying to make the text of time and date bigger, but not matter how much
I tried increasing the panel width or increasing the font size in the settings
nothing worked and the text remained tiny.
Until I changed "Time Display" to "24-Hour", suddenly the text got bigger.
It seems "12-Hour" and "region defaults" options on "Time Display" are broken,
because using "24-Hour" option the setting to manually change font and size
affects the text as it should.

STEPS TO REPRODUCE
1. Right Click on Digital Clock
2. Click Configure Digital Clock
3. Try change "Text Display" settings

OBSERVED RESULT
Time and Date size in the panel remain tiny when you increase font size.

EXPECTED RESULT
The text change in side as you change the settings.


SOFTWARE/OS VERSIONS
Operating System (available in the Info Center app, or by running `kinfo` in a
terminal window): SUSE Tumbleweed
KDE Plasma Version: 6.7.1
KDE Frameworks Version: 6.27.0
Qt Version: 6.11.1
